BPO techie gets Rs 6 lakh raise
By Bala Shah

Ohio head quartered Convergys is one of the most successful BPO’s in the world. Convergys delivers a broad range of customer solutions which include technology, business analytics and consulting.  It employs a workforce of 74,000 at 125 centers in 60 countries across the globe. It has a huge footprint in India with offices in Bangalore, Gurgaon, Hyd, Mumbai, Thane and Pune.

Software giant Microsoft and Citi are among its many blue chip clients.

A Tipster in Convergys, Gurgaon tells us that Microsoft EPS (Enterprise Server Technologies Support) is one of its extremely technical Processes.  By all accounts, this Microsoft Process at Convergys has some of the best technical skills in the organization.  Every person working in the Process is expected to have good knowledge of Microsoft products including its operating systems, applications,  Microsoft Services, Web Servers, Enterprise servers etc.  Every time Microsoft launches a new product and / or update, these techies at Convergys burn the midnight oil to master that piece of software.

How good are the skill sets of everyone in this team? As reported by Techgoss earlier, each person in this tech team is required to sit a practical test every month.  And if you fail the test 3 times in a row, you have to resign.  Late 2010, Techgoss had exclusively reported on the huge bonuses offered to this tech savvy team

In the third week of March, 2011, one of our tech guru colleagues at the Microsoft EPS at Convergys, Gurgaon hit it big.  Our colleague, Anil Sood, who was working as Level 2 Support at Convergys was handpicked by Microsoft to work at the Microsoft Global Technical Support Center (GTSE) in Bangalore.

Microsoft have outsourced their first and second level support to the EPS Team at Convergys, but handle the level 3 (highly technical calls) themselves.

Microsoft visited our offices at Gurgaon to select a few candidates to move from Convergys to their own offices in Bangalore.  Four people were short listed of which only Anil Sood made the final cut.

Anil was on Rs. 3.5 Lakhs a year at Convergys, but after being selected by Microsoft to join GTSE, his salary now moves up to Rs. 9.6 Lakhs.
